包含vuedata-id的词条

Vue.js是一种流行的JavaScript框架,它被广泛应用于Web开发中。本文将介绍Vue.js的一些基本概念和技术特性,并且说明如何在项目中使用它。

## Vue.js简介

Vue.js是一个开源的JavaScript框架,由尤雨溪创建。它的核心是响应式数据绑定和组件化的架构。Vue.js的主要特点包括:

- 简洁:Vue.js提供了一套简洁的API,使得开发者能够快速上手。

- 响应式:Vue.js使用数据驱动的方式来构建界面,当数据发生变化时,界面会自动更新。

- 组件化:Vue.js允许开发者将页面拆分成多个组件,每个组件可以独立开发和测试。

## Vue.js的核心概念

### 数据驱动

Vue.js采用双向数据绑定的方式来实现数据驱动。开发者将数据绑定到视图上,当数据发生变化时,视图会自动更新。

### 组件化

Vue.js的组件化思想让页面拆分成多个独立且可复用的组件。每个组件包含自己的视图、数据和方法。

### 生命周期钩子

Vue.js提供了一些生命周期钩子函数,可以在组件的不同阶段执行逻辑操作。比如created、mounted等。

## 如何使用Vue.js

### 安装Vue.js

可以通过npm或者CDN引入Vue.js。npm安装示例:`npm install vue`。

### 创建Vue实例

使用`new Vue()`来创建Vue实例,并传入选项对象。选项对象包括数据、方法、生命周期钩子等。

### 编写模板

使用Vue.js的模板语法(插值、指令、事件等)来构建视图。

### 绑定数据

使用`v-bind`指令将数据绑定到视图上。比如`

`。

### 响应用户事件

使用`v-on`指令来监听DOM事件并执行对应的方法。比如``。

## 总结

Vue.js是一个功能强大且易于学习的JavaScript框架,它提供了丰富的功能和灵活的组件化开发方式。通过本文的介绍,希望读者能够快速上手Vue.js,并在项目中实践应用。

标签列表